I am working with a digital agency who is looking for an experienced Shopify Developer to oversee complex Shopify projects. They work with clients within the Formula 1 & Retail industries.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ience with Shopify development and a passion for leadership.
Role Overview:
- Development and optimisation of custom Shopify themes and applications using Liquid, JavaScript, HTML, and CSS.
- Architect scalable solutions and optimise store performance and reliability.
- Drive the frontend tech stack and ensure best practices are followed across the team.
Shopify experience is essential for this role.
Key Skills & Experience:
- Expert in Shopify development, Liquid templating, JavaScript, HTML, CSS, and Shopify APIs.
- Knowledge of React frameworks (NextJS, RemixJS), TypeScript, TailwindCSS, and Chakra UI is a plus.
- Proven leadership experience with a strong ability to mentor and guide a development team.
- Strong problem-solving skills and ability to resolve complex technical challenges.
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to explain techn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
